Hi, not sure what has been triggering, except for trying another laptop with a newer EKOS release. After issues encountered when capturing images, following polar alignment I returned to my ‚standard laptop’, which I used before successfully. However, issues remained, i.e. whenever attempting to capture an image, the exposure countdown is being started in endless cycles.

Log file attached. This seems to be the critical part:

ZWO CCD ASI071MC Pro : "[DEBUG] ASIGetExpStatus failed. Restarting exposure... "

Can anyone help or advise what to do?

This is the same problem I have now with my ASI1600MM. I have tried reinstalling, rebooting and trying over and over with and without other accessories. I can't get the ASI camera to work. After one or two exposures, I get the same error:

[DEBUG] ASIGetExpStatus failed. Restarting exposure...

I solved my problem by switching back to a USB2 cable instead of the USB3.
